We have ferrets so we know what the poo can smell like (trust me, I just cleaned their cage.) Ours are not litterbox trained, not even in their own cage. (We are in the process of training.) And so we make sure that all out of cage play is supervised (they let theirs run around at night in the room unsupervised while they sleep), and if there are any signs of impending poopage (backing up into a corner) we scoop them up and put them in the litterbox/cage. If we don't catch them in time, we clean up the poop. Simple, no?
My daughter use to have ferrets and sometimes training is not so simple! They are fast little buggers, and when you have more than one it can be a handful to litter box train them! She use to put a triangle litter box in every corner of her room to help them to figure it out (when they were outside of their multi-level cage). It became pretty hopeless though; they just weren't consistent with the location of their poopage!!
